Year Total CO2e (MT)
2023 175,522
2022 181,610
2021 314,949
2020 302,873
2019 252,980
2018 195,944
2017 184,505
2016 201,431
2015 186,903
2014 163,920
2013 207,621
2012 244,810
2011 292,350

Facility insight: Covel Gardens Recycling and Disposal Facility

Covel Gardens Recycling and Disposal Facility (GHGRP ID 1003439) is a high-volume reporter at 176K MT CO₂e in 2023 from San Antonio, TX (#1,803 of 8,713 nationally) under Waste (NAICS 562212).

Across 2011–2023, annual CO₂e fell 40.0%; peak load was 315K MT in 2021. This facility has filed every year from 2011 to 2023, a complete 13-year record.

Peak year was 2021 at 315K MT CO2e; latest 2023 sits 44.3% below that peak (176K MT). The largest year-to-year move was 2021→2022 (-42.3%, 133K MT).
